The sign is called the "Expansion panel - without oncoming traffic with integrated sign 275 2-lane plus lane to the left."
This sign indicates a specific road arrangement where the road ahead is expanding to accommodate two lanes of traffic in your direction, and an additional lane is dedicated for left turns. The absence of oncoming traffic suggests that the road is designed to facilitate smooth traffic flow on this side, likely because there is a median or some other barrier preventing vehicles from coming towards you.
Drivers should be aware of this configuration to effectively navigate through the lanes, especially when preparing to turn left. The sign helps to inform drivers about how the road will change and encourages safe lane changes and turns in a busy area.
